Freigeben über


AdminRule Konstruktoren

Definition

Überlädt

AdminRule()

Initialisiert eine neue instance der AdminRule-Klasse.

AdminRule(String, String, Int32, String, String, String, String, String, SystemData, String, IList<AddressPrefixItem>, IList<AddressPrefixItem>, IList<String>, IList<String>, String)

Initialisiert eine neue instance der AdminRule-Klasse.

AdminRule()

Initialisiert eine neue instance der AdminRule-Klasse.

public AdminRule ();
Public Sub New ()

Gilt für:

AdminRule(String, String, Int32, String, String, String, String, String, SystemData, String, IList<AddressPrefixItem>, IList<AddressPrefixItem>, IList<String>, IList<String>, String)

Initialisiert eine neue instance der AdminRule-Klasse.

public AdminRule (string protocol, string access, int priority, string direction, string id = default, string name = default, string type = default, string etag = default, Microsoft.Azure.Management.Network.Models.SystemData systemData = default, string description =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.AddressPrefixItem> sources =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.AddressPrefixItem> destinations = default, System.Collections.Generic.IList<string> sourcePortRanges = default, System.Collections.Generic.IList<string> destinationPortRanges = default, string provisioningState = default);
new Microsoft.Azure.Management.Network.Models.AdminRule : string * string * int * string * string * string * string * string * Microsoft.Azure.Management.Network.Models.SystemData * string *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.AddressPrefixItem>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.AddressPrefixItem> * System.Collections.Generic.IList<string> * System.Collections.Generic.IList<string> * string -> Microsoft.Azure.Management.Network.Models.AdminRule
Public Sub New (protocol As String, access As String, priority As Integer, direction As String,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ional etag As String = Nothing, Optional systemData As SystemData = Nothing, Optional description As String = Nothing, Optional sources As IList(Of AddressPrefixItem) = Nothing, Optional destinations As IList(Of AddressPrefixItem) = Nothing, Optional sourcePortRanges As IList(Of String) = Nothing, Optional destinationPortRanges As IList(Of String) = Nothing, Optional provisioningState As String = Nothing)

Parameter

protocol
String

Netzwerkprotokoll, für das diese Regel gilt. Mögliche Werte: "Tcp", "Udp", "Icmp", "Esp", "Any", "Ah"

access
String

Gibt den für diese regel zulässigen Zugriff an. Mögliche Werte: "Allow", "Deny", "AlwaysAllow"

priority
Int32

Die Priorität der Regel. Der Wert kann zwischen 1 und 4096 sein. Die Prioritätsnummer muss für jede Regel in der Auflistung eindeutig sein. Je niedrigere die Prioritätsnummer ist, desto höher ist die Priorität der Regel.

direction
String

Gibt an, ob der Datenverkehr ein- oder ausgehend mit der Regel übereinstimmt. Mögliche Werte: "Eingehend", "Ausgehend"

id
String

Ressourcen-ID

name
String

Name der Ressource.

type
String

Der Ressourcentyp.

etag
String

Eine eindeutige schreibgeschützte Zeichenfolge, die sich ändert, wenn die Ressource aktualisiert wird.

systemData
SystemData

Die Systemmetadaten, die sich auf diese Ressource beziehen.

description
String

Eine Beschreibung für diese Regel. Auf 140 Zeichen beschränkt.

sources
IList<AddressPrefixItem>

Die CIDR- oder Quell-IP-Bereiche.

destinations
IList<AddressPrefixItem>

Die Zieladresspräfixe. CIDR- oder Ziel-IP-Bereiche.

sourcePortRanges
IList<String>

Die Quellportbereiche.

destinationPortRanges
IList<String>

Die Zielportbereiche.

provisioningState
String

Der Bereitstellungsstatus der Ressource. Mögliche Werte: "Succeeded", "Updating", "Deleting", "Failed"

Gilt für: